Shingle roof installation is a crucial aspect of home construction and maintenance, providing a durable and aesthetically pleasing protective layer for residential and commercial properties. This process involves laying shingles, typically made from asphalt, wood, or slate, in an overlapping manner to ensure a watertight seal. Proper installation is vital as it affects the roof's longevity, energy efficiency, and overall protection against the elements. A well-installed shingle roof not only enhances the curb appeal of a property but also safeguards it from weather-related damage, thus preserving the structural integrity of the building. Benefits of Shingle Roof Installation
-
Cost-Effectiveness
Shingle roofs are known for their affordability compared to other roofing materials. Asphalt shingles, in particular, offer a budget-friendly option without compromising on quality or durability. This makes them an excellent choice for homeowners looking to balance cost with performance. -
Versatility in Design
Shingle roofs come in a wide variety of colors, styles, and textures, allowing homeowners to customize the look of their property. This versatility ensures that the roof complements the architectural style of the building, enhancing its visual appeal and potentially increasing property value. -
Ease of Installation and Repair
The installation process for shingle roofs is relatively straightforward, which can lead to quicker project completion times. Additionally, individual shingles can be easily replaced if damaged, simplifying maintenance and reducing long-term repair costs. This ease of installation and repair makes shingle roofs a practical choice for many property owners.
